Home Water Filtration in Denver, CO
Home water filtration services involve installing and maintaining systems designed to improve the quality of tap water throughout a residence. These services typically cover projects such as installing whole-house filtration units, under-sink filters, or point-of-use systems to reduce contaminants like chlorine, sediment, lead, and other impurities. Property owners often seek these services to ensure cleaner, safer drinking water, enhance the taste and odor of water, or address specific concerns related to local water quality. Understanding the type of contaminants present and the desired level of filtration can help homeowners determine the most suitable system for their needs.
Before requesting home water filtration services, property owners usually want to know about the different types of filtration options available, the maintenance requirements, and the expected benefits. It’s also helpful to consider the size of the household, water usage patterns, and any specific water quality issues identified through testing. Clarifying these details can ensure that the chosen filtration system effectively addresses individual household needs and provides reliable, high-quality water for everyday use.

Common Home Water Filtration Jobs
Whole House Filtration - removes contaminants from all household water sources for improved quality.
Point-of-Use Filters - installed at specific faucets or appliances to target particular water needs.
Reverse Osmosis Systems - provide advanced filtration for clean, great-tasting drinking water.
Sediment and Dirt Removal - prevents clogging and damage by filtering out particles before they enter plumbing.
Water Softening - reduces hard water minerals to prevent scale buildup and improve appliance lifespan.
Custom Water Filtration Solutions - tailored systems designed to meet the specific water quality needs of a home.
Home Water Filtration Questions
What types of water filtration systems are available? There are various systems including point-of-use filters, whole-house systems, and specialty filters designed to remove specific contaminants from drinking water and household supply.
How do I know if my water needs filtration? Signs include unusual tastes or odors, visible sediment, or if water tests indicate high levels of minerals, chemicals, or other impurities.
What benefits does water filtration provide? Filtration can improve water taste, reduce contaminants, and help protect plumbing and appliances from mineral buildup.
Are maintenance requirements for water filtration systems? Most systems require regular filter replacements or cleaning to ensure optimal performance and water quality.
